Senior System Engineer Radar SoC - Product Line Detect(m/w/x)
Optimizing radar algorithm HWAs for throughput and power consumption with semiconductor suppliers. Extensive radar SoC architecture experience required. Company pension allowance, scope to develop own ideas.
Requirements
- Master's or PhD in Microelectronics, Electrical Engineering, or Semiconductor Physics
- Extensive Radar SoC architecture experience
- Deep knowledge of RFCMOS technology
- Deep knowledge of digital back-end processing
- Proven track record implementing complex signal processing algorithms on HWAs or specialized DSPs
- Strong understanding of silicon performance and radar KPIs interaction
- Ability to negotiate technical trade-offs with external suppliers
- Ability to present complex architectural choices to management
Tasks
- Act as primary technical interface with key semiconductor suppliers
- Align supplier product roadmaps with Valeo’s requirements
- Optimize Hardware Accelerator (HWA) architectures for radar algorithms
- Maximize throughput and minimize power consumption in HWA designs
- Assess and benchmark competitor chipsets
- Perform deep-dive analyses on internal architectures, memory bandwidth, and processing latencies
- Define high-level requirements for next-generation Radar SoCs
- Specify ADC sampling rates, phase noise requirements, and integrated DSP/HWA capabilities
- Collaborate with System and Hardware Architects
- Ensure chip technology aligns with radar sensor constraints
- Provide high-level troubleshooting for complex chip-level issues
- Resolve hardware-software interface bottlenecks and RF front-end non-linearities
